Output 39b4c259ae49971e41ba3e582536325092a13483efe43761aa5c7edf6653b4d2:6

value
5094805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a28c51b87a3abf864d3dfc954407d5102b717c OP_EQUAL
address
3FEveya5dLaBHXUK68KCAwhoDUPVR4qAbi
transaction
39b4c259ae49971e41ba3e582536325092a13483efe43761aa5c7edf6653b4d2
spent
true